How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Olde Torrance Neighborhood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Olde Torrance Neighborhood Studio Apartments | $1,006 | $1,006 | $1,006 |
| Olde Torrance Neighborhood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,160 | $1,995 | $2,667 |
| Olde Torrance Neighborhood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,525 | $2,500 | $2,550 |
| Olde Torrance Neighborhood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,698 | $3,295 | $4,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Olde Torrance Neighborhood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Olde Torrance Neighborhood with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Olde Torrance Neighborhood is at The Dorms of Torrance listed at $1,006.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Olde Torrance Neighborhood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Olde Torrance Neighborhood is $1,006.
What is the average size for Olde Torrance Neighborhood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Olde Torrance Neighborhood is currently 300 sq ft.
